Output 9585d228e5ea59fbdf3ffec28a2425ac2a9fecba8f8ea1c157d30d109afffb7d:0

value
40351470
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a788f9a4f39eb81f0df80357772b3fce89c6b2e OP_EQUAL
address
3FmnQomcXrAE5Tii7gLpxeWXdHgJcZ7J4o
transaction
9585d228e5ea59fbdf3ffec28a2425ac2a9fecba8f8ea1c157d30d109afffb7d
confirmations
304514
spent
true